How Do I Price My Scrapbook Making Services For Optimal Profit?
To ensure your scrapbook making service business, like Memory Lane Makers, achieves optimal profit, a smart pricing strategy is crucial. This involves combining a cost-plus approach with value-based pricing. You need to meticulously account for all your expenses while also recognizing the unique worth of the personalized heirlooms you create. This dual approach helps maximize scrapbook service income effectively.
Calculating profit margins for custom photo albums requires a thorough breakdown of costs. Start with direct costs, which include all materials like paper, embellishments, and binding, as well as any specialized tools you use. Then, factor in indirect costs. This is where you assign a competitive hourly rate for your labor – many creative professionals in the US earn between $25-$75 per hour, depending on experience and location. Don't forget overheads such as marketing expenses, software subscriptions for design or accounting, and even a portion of your home office costs. For instance, if your materials for a custom album total $50 and you estimate 10 hours of labor at $30 per hour, your direct cost is $350. Adding a reasonable profit margin of 15-25% on top of that would set your base price between $402.50 and $437.50. This ensures you’re not just covering costs but building a healthy scrapbook business profit.
It's vital to research competitor pricing within the craft business revenue landscape. Understanding what other custom design services charge for similar high-quality, personalized heirlooms will help you position your own rates. Aim for prices that are competitive enough to attract clients but also reflect your unique artistic flair and professional quality. This helps attract high-paying clients to your scrapbook service, directly impacting your scrapbook making business profit. For example, a well-established custom scrapbook service might charge anywhere from $300 to $1,000+ for a premium, elaborately designed album, depending on the complexity and number of pages.
Tiered Pricing Models for Enhanced Profitability
- Basic Package: Ideal for budget-conscious clients, this might include a set number of pages (e.g., 20 pages), a limited selection of embellishments, and standard photo printing. Price this to cover costs and a modest profit, perhaps around $250-$350.
- Premium Package: Offering more value, this tier could feature more pages (e.g., 30 pages), a wider range of premium materials, custom-designed layouts, and perhaps a digital copy of the scrapbook. Aim for a profit margin of 20-30%, pricing it around $450-$650.
- Deluxe Package: This is your top-tier offering, designed for maximum perceived value and profit. It might include unlimited pages, the highest quality archival materials, bespoke embellishments, professional photo retouching, and expedited service. With higher profit margins, potentially 30-40%, this package could be priced from $700 upwards.
Offering these tiered options allows clients to select a service that aligns with their budget and desired level of customization. Higher-priced packages typically carry higher profit margins, which is a key strategy to boost scrapbook profits significantly. This also helps in upselling techniques for scrapbook design packages, as clients might be persuaded to upgrade to a premium or deluxe option once they see the added value.

Brainstorm Strategies To Optimize Operational Costs In A Scrapbook Making Service
Optimizing operational costs is a cornerstone for any scrapbook making service aiming to maximize its profit margins. By focusing on key areas like material procurement and labor efficiency, Memory Lane Makers can significantly boost its creative service profitability and overall scrapbook making business profit.
Streamline Material Procurement for Cost Savings
To effectively manage expenses, implementing bulk purchasing strategies for essential supplies is paramount. Buying materials such as high-quality cardstock, archival-safe adhesives, and decorative embellishments in larger quantities can yield substantial savings. For instance, purchasing supplies in bulk can lead to 10-25% savings compared to retail prices. This directly impacts the calculation of profit margins for custom photo albums, allowing the business to offer competitive pricing while maintaining healthy earnings.
Enhance Labor Efficiency Through Process Optimization
Improving labor efficiency is another critical strategy to boost scrapbook business revenue. Streamlining the design and production workflow can drastically reduce the time spent on each project. This can be achieved through methods like creating standardized templates for popular scrapbook layouts or utilizing digital mock-ups for client approvals. Automating processes in a scrapbook service for efficiency can cut down labor hours per project by an estimated 10-15%. This frees up valuable time for the artist to take on more projects or focus on client consultation, ultimately contributing to scrapbook service growth.
Minimize Material Waste for Increased Profitability
Reducing material waste is a direct route to increasing the profit margins for a custom scrapbook service. Meticulous planning of page layouts before cutting materials ensures that as much of the paper and embellishments are used as possible. Effective waste management techniques, such as utilizing smaller scraps for intricate details or creating complementary embellishments, can reduce material costs by 5-10% annually. This careful approach to resource management enhances handmade product pricing and supports the overall financial management for a home-based scrapbook business.
Key Operational Cost Optimization Tactics
- Bulk Purchasing: Acquire common materials like paper, adhesives, and embellishments in larger quantities to secure discounts. This strategy can reduce material costs by 10-25%.
- Process Streamlining: Develop templates for recurring layouts or use digital mock-ups for client approvals to reduce revision time and improve production speed. This can lower labor hours per project by 10-15%.
- Waste Reduction: Implement meticulous planning for page layouts and creatively reuse smaller material scraps for accents or future projects. This can lead to a 5-10% annual reduction in material expenses.
Brainstorm Strategies To Improve Customer Lifetime Value In A Scrapbook Making Service
To maximize scrapbook making business profit, focus on strategies that enhance customer lifetime value (CLV). This means encouraging clients to return for future projects, thereby boosting overall scrapbook service growth and revenue. A key element is building strong client relationships and offering continuous value beyond the initial purchase.
Deliver Exceptional Customer Service for Repeat Business
Providing outstanding customer service is fundamental to increasing customer lifetime value. When clients feel their cherished memories are handled with care and expertise, they are more likely to become repeat customers. Studies show that satisfied customers are approximately 80% more likely to make repeat purchases. This personalized attention throughout the project lifecycle, from initial consultation to final delivery, fosters loyalty and encourages positive word-of-mouth referrals, directly contributing to scrapbook business strategies for increased profit.
Offer Follow-Up Services and Companion Products
To scale a scrapbook making service for increased income, consider offering follow-up services or 'anniversary' packages. This could include adding new pages to an existing scrapbook to commemorate new milestones or creating companion albums for significant life events, such as a second child or a memorable trip. These offerings provide ongoing value to the customer and create natural opportunities for repeat business, helping to boost scrapbook profits effectively.
Implement a Loyalty Program and Referral Incentives
A well-structured loyalty program can significantly improve customer retention and drive scrapbook service growth. Offer returning clients a discount on their next project or provide a bonus for referring new customers. Research indicates that referred customers exhibit a 37% higher retention rate compared to those acquired through other channels. This strategy not only rewards existing clients but also attracts new ones, directly impacting your scrapbook making business profit and overall revenue.
Key Strategies for Enhancing Customer Lifetime Value
- Personalized Communication: Maintain consistent, thoughtful communication throughout the project to build rapport.
- Follow-Up Services: Propose adding pages for new events or creating companion albums to encourage repeat business.
- Loyalty Programs: Reward repeat customers with discounts or special offers to foster continued engagement.
- Referral Incentives: Encourage existing clients to refer new business by offering rewards for successful referrals, leveraging the higher retention rate of referred customers.

Brainstorm Strategies To Create Premium Scrapbook Packages For Higher Profit
To effectively boost your scrapbook making business profit, focus on developing premium package options. This involves bundling high-value services, offering exclusive materials, and providing expedited turnaround times. These strategies allow you to cater to clients seeking a more elevated experience and justify a higher price point, directly contributing to your scrapbook service growth.
Design 'Heirloom' or 'Legacy' Packages
Creating 'heirloom' or 'legacy' packages is a key scrapbook business strategy to maximize scrapbook service income. These premium offerings should include top-tier materials, such as archival-quality paper, genuine leather covers, and custom debossing. By increasing the page count and positioning these as luxury products, you can price them 50-100% higher than standard options. This significant price increase directly impacts your scrapbook making business profit.
Incorporate Value-Added Services
Enhance the perceived value of your premium scrapbook packages by incorporating value-added services. These can include professional photo scanning, digital restoration of old photos, or a personalized consultation session with the artist. Such services not only justify a higher price point but also differentiate your craft business revenue from competitors. This approach helps to boost scrapbook profits by offering a more comprehensive and specialized service.
Offer Expedited Service as a Premium Option
For clients with urgent deadlines, offering expedited service as a premium option is an effective way to increase your scrapbook making business profit. Charging an additional 20-30% premium for faster turnaround times caters to a specific client need and adds another layer of profitability to your custom scrapbook services. This strategy taps into a segment of the market willing to pay more for convenience and speed, contributing to your creative service profitability.
Premium Scrapbook Package Components
- Exclusive Materials: Archival-quality paper, genuine leather covers, custom debossing.
- Enhanced Page Count: More pages to tell a richer story.
- Value-Added Services: Photo scanning, digital restoration, artist consultations.
- Expedited Turnaround: Faster completion for urgent needs.
Brainstorm Strategies To Find Profitable Niche Markets For Scrapbook Making Service Profitability
To maximize profits for your scrapbook making business, identifying and targeting specific niche markets is crucial. This involves pinpointing underserved customer segments and then tailoring your services and products to meet their unique needs. By focusing on specialized areas, you can often command premium pricing due to the high emotional value customers place on these personalized keepsakes, directly boosting your scrapbook making business profit.
Specializing in life events can significantly increase revenue. Consider focusing on specific occasions such as wedding scrapbooks, baby's first year albums, memorial scrapbooks, or milestone birthday and anniversary albums. For instance, custom wedding-related products often see a price increase of 20-50% compared to general-purpose albums. This premium pricing structure is a key strategy to maximize scrapbook service income.
Targeting specific demographics also opens up profitable avenues. Military families, who often need to preserve memories during deployments, or individuals documenting extensive travel experiences represent strong niche markets. Creating personalized scrapbooks for these groups addresses unique memory-preservation needs, fostering strong client loyalty and increasing customer lifetime value in your custom album service.
Niche Market Examples for Scrapbook Making Services
- Wedding Scrapbooks: High emotional value, allows for premium pricing.
- Baby's First Year Albums: Captures significant milestones, sought after by new parents.
- Memorial Scrapbooks: Sensitive and highly personal, often commissioned for remembrance.
- Travel Experience Albums: Documents extensive journeys, appeals to avid travelers.
- Military Family Memory Books: Preserves memories during deployments and service.
Exploring the business-to-business (B2B) sector offers another avenue for significant scrapbook service growth. Offering corporate gifting or event scrapbooking for businesses can lead to larger, recurring projects. This includes creating custom albums for company milestones, retreats, or product launches. Such B2B engagements can generate higher-volume orders, substantially boosting overall scrapbook profits and contributing to effective scrapbook business strategies.
